Hamirpur, May 26

A leopard cub entered a house at Aghaar village near the Aghaar forest range in the district following a forest fire on Saturday.

The family initially mistook the cub to be a cat. The cub was one-month old. Villagers informed the Forest Range Officer who took the cub into custody.

There have been over 34 incidents of forest fires in the district this summer. The forest fires have caused a huge loss of flora and fauna in the district. Wildlife experts said the summer was the breeding time for most of the wild animals and effort should not only be to protect trees but also wildlife.

Preeti Bhandari, Divisional Forest Officer, here said the leopard cub that had entered a house at Aghaar village was under the care of the Forest Department. The cub was too young, so the department was trying to locate its mother so that it could be released. If the mother leopard was not found, it would be handed over to the wildlife wing of the department, she added.
